I got there during the 2nd half of the 2nd game. I was really wanting to see a monster dunk from Rashon and of course was reading up on the team rosters when he had one. I really was impressed with Dunson as he played well but wasn't cocky. McIntosh was pretty impressive to watch as he was up against Sears(Creighton) and did pretty well, but he was talking smack a lot too. I like more of the prove your play and leave the smack talk out of it. I was very impressed with Corey Johnson. He did brick some 3 pointers in the first half, but his "in the paint" play I thought was very good. Very aggressive, fast and quite physical down low. Add some bulk to that frame and he is going to be fun to watch. Marsden did have some good play and shots, but he needs to be more physical down low and be more assertive on his post up shots. I agree with CYS8T that Haluska was a very impressive player and I think ISU should give him some look, as he was very aggressive in every phase of his game. He took it down against the bigs and did quite well I thought. Tyler Peterson showed as an EX- ISU/UNI player and looked familiar, but I don't remember when he played.
